A new Taco Bell restaurant is slated to become the first entirely solar-powered store in the 6,000-unit chain, according to Grover Moss, the franchisee who owns the Moreno Valley, Calif., store and 11 other units.

Nearly a year after opening its first restaurant built to U.S. Green Building Council's LEED certification standards, Chick-fil-A has received LEED Gold certification.
